首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

替换字符串中的元素

是指将字符串中的特定元素替换为其他元素或字符串。这在编程中经常用于字符串处理和数据清洗的操作中。下面是一个完善且全面的答案:

替换字符串中的元素可以通过多种方式实现,具体取决于编程语言和开发环境。以下是一些常见的方法:

  1. 使用内置函数或方法:大多数编程语言都提供了内置的字符串处理函数或方法,可以用于替换字符串中的元素。例如,在Python中,可以使用replace()方法来替换字符串中的元素。示例代码如下:
代码语言:python
代码运行次数:0
复制
string = "Hello, World!"
new_string = string.replace("World", "Universe")
print(new_string)

输出结果为:"Hello, Universe!"

  1. 使用正则表达式:如果需要根据特定的模式进行替换,可以使用正则表达式。正则表达式可以匹配字符串中的特定模式,并进行替换操作。不同的编程语言对正则表达式的支持程度有所不同,但大多数语言都提供了相关的库或模块。以下是一个使用正则表达式替换字符串中的元素的示例:
代码语言:python
代码运行次数:0
复制
import re

string = "Hello, 123!"
new_string = re.sub(r'\d+', '456', string)
print(new_string)

输出结果为:"Hello, 456!"

  1. 使用循环和条件语句:在一些较为简单的情况下,可以使用循环和条件语句来逐个遍历字符串中的字符,并根据需要进行替换。以下是一个使用循环和条件语句替换字符串中的元素的示例:
代码语言:python
代码运行次数:0
复制
string = "Hello, World!"
new_string = ""
for char in string:
    if char == "o":
        new_string += "x"
    else:
        new_string += char
print(new_string)

输出结果为:"Hellx, Wxrld!"

替换字符串中的元素在实际开发中有广泛的应用场景,例如数据清洗、文本处理、模板替换等。对于不同的应用场景,可以选择不同的方法来实现替换操作。

腾讯云提供了多个与字符串处理相关的产品和服务,例如云函数(Serverless)、云开发(CloudBase)、人工智能(AI)等。您可以根据具体需求选择适合的产品和服务。更多关于腾讯云产品和服务的信息,请访问腾讯云官方网站:腾讯云

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

3分23秒

081 - Java入门极速版 - 基础语法 - 常用类和对象 - 字符串 - 替换

4分16秒

14.Groovy中的字符串及三大语句结构

7分32秒

用来替换Redis的Apache 顶级项目 - Kvrocks

7分58秒

06_Fragment的动态替换与移除.avi

2分49秒

python开发视频课程5.5判断某个元素是否在序列中

15秒

Python中如何将字符串转化为整形

1分43秒

C语言 | 用指向元素的指针变量输出二维数组元素的值

17分5秒

day05_96_尚硅谷_硅谷p2p金融_重写的onLayout方法中初始化集合元素

11分25秒

day20_常用类/10-尚硅谷-Java语言高级-JVM中涉及字符串的内存结构

9分51秒

day20_常用类/10-尚硅谷-Java语言高级-JVM中涉及字符串的内存结构

9分51秒

day20_常用类/10-尚硅谷-Java语言高级-JVM中涉及字符串的内存结构

2分23秒

在谷歌Chrome网页中播放海康威视RTSP视频流在播放窗口内叠加网页元素?

领券